Latest web development tutorials

dyrektywy JSP

Dyrektywa JSP ustawić całą JSP strony podobne atrybuty, takie jak kodowanie strony i języków skryptowych.

Składnia jest następująca:

<%@ directive attribute="value" %>

Instrukcje mogą mieć szereg właściwości, które w postaci par klucz-wartość, oddzielonych przecinkami.

Te trzy rodzaje instrukcji znaczników JSP:

instrukcja opis
<% @ Page ...%> Atrybuty niestandardowe Strona zależne, takie jak język skryptowy, stron błędów, wymagania pamięci podręcznej, itp
<% @ Include ...%> Zawiera ona dodatkowe pliki
<% @ Taglib ...%> Wprowadzenie niestandardowej biblioteki znaczników

dyrektywa Page

Komenda strona zawiera aktualne instrukcje dotyczące strony wykorzystanie pojemnika. Strona JSP może zawierać wiele instrukcji stron.

Strona Składnia polecenia:

<%@ page attribute="value" %>

Odpowiednik w formacie XML:

<jsp:directive.page attribute="value" />

nieruchomość

Poniższa tabela zawiera listę atrybutów związanych z dyrektywą strony:

nieruchomość opis
bufor Określa rozmiar bufora obiektów z
autoFlush kontrola na zewnątrz obiektu cache
contentType Określ aktualny typ MIME oraz kodowanie znaków strony JSP
errorPage Określa wyjątek występuje, gdy strona JSP trzeba zwrócić się do strony obsługi błędów
isErrorPage Określa, czy bieżąca strona może być traktowane jako stronę błędu do innej strony JSP
rozszerza Określa gdzie A dziedziczenie klasy serwletu
import Klasa importu Java, aby użyć
Informacje Zdefiniowane opis strony JSP
isThreadSafe Dostęp do określenia, czy strona bezpieczne dla wątków JSP
język język skryptowy używany do definiowania stronę JSP, domyślnie jest Java
sesja Określa, czy strony JSP używać sesji
isELIgnored Określa, czy wyrażenia EL
isScriptingEnabled Może on być używany do określenia elementów skryptu

zawierają instrukcje

JSP może zawierać inne pliki zawierają wskazówki. Dołączone pliki mogą być pliki JSP, HTML lub plików tekstowych. Plik zawiera jest jak części pliku JSP zostanie skompilowany jednocześnie wykonywane.

Składnia polecenia zawierają się następująco:

<%@ include file="文件相对 url 地址" %>

to instrukcja w pliku jest w rzeczywistości względne adres URL.

Jeśli nie masz skojarzyć ścieżkę do pliku, JSP domyślnie kompilator, aby znaleźć się w bieżącej ścieżce.

Odpowiednik składni XML:

<jsp:directive.include file="文件相对 url 地址" />

instrukcja tagLib

JSP API pozwala użytkownikom dostosować etykietę, biblioteka niestandardowy znacznik jest zbiorem niestandardowych etykiet.

Dyrektywa TagLib wprowadza niestandardowe zdefiniowane zestaw znaczników, w tym ścieżki biblioteki, niestandardowych etykiet.

TagLib polecenie składni:

<%@ taglib uri="uri" prefix="prefixOfTag" %>

atrybut uri określa położenie biblioteki znaczników, atrybutów prefix Określa prefiks biblioteki znaczników.

Odpowiednik składni XML:

<jsp:directive.taglib uri="uri" prefix="prefixOfTag" />